Significance of Candida albicans
Candida albicans is a significant fungal organism frequently tested for antimicrobial activity in various studies. As a common pathogenic yeast, it is known to cause a range of infections, particularly in immunocompromised individuals. Its susceptibility to different extracts and compounds has been assessed, revealing its role as a target for antifungal activity. This species is responsible for candidiasis, affecting various body parts, and is prevalent in environments conducive to infection. Its importance is underscored in many research contexts focused on antifungal efficacy.
